The U.S. automotive market has long balanced ownership and rental dynamics. Travel demands, shifting household budgets, and the growing emphasis on flexible transportation solutions have created fertile ground for innovation in car rental economics. A growing number of users are realizing that traditional new car purchases come with steep depreciation and maintenance costs—especially when used for temporary needs. Rental used cars, when strategically leveraged, offer a compelling alternative with built-in savings that often go unnoticed. This shift reflects deeper economic awareness: buyers and renters alike are seeking smarter, more flexible mobility without long-term commitment.

Why are more people turning to rental used cars not just for convenience—but for game-changing savings? In an era defined by rising costs and value-seeking consumers, a quiet trend is emerging: rationalizing car purchases through strategic use of rental used vehicles. At the heart of this movement lies a powerful concept—hidden savings embedded in rental used cars—offering unexpected financial benefits to budget-conscious travelers, commuters, and business drivers across the U.S. This article reveals how individuals are unlocking value beneath the surface, revealing detailed, trustworthy pathways to cost efficiency—no complex jargon, no exaggeration, just straightforward insight.

Rental used cars aren’t just a backup—they’re a financially intelligent option. Many users discover that rental agreements often include full-service packages: insurance, routine maintenance, and roadside assistance—all bundled at a fraction of ownership expense. This reduces surprise costs and lowers the total financial burden.
